Homework help, Night rider Leds by Photooops in PLC

[–]docfunbags 1 point2 points  (0 children)

How fancy does this need to be?

Easiest if you just need the light to move from position 1-8 is to use a TON for how fast you want the light to transfer.

TON T_Scan: I_Switch AND NOT T_Scan.DN

Then a counter C_STep from 0-13.

LED 1: EQU C_Step.ACC 0

LED 2: EQU C_Step.ACC 1 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 13

LED 3: EQU C_Step.ACC 2 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 12

LED 4: EQU C_Step.ACC 3 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 11

LED 5: EQU C_Step.ACC 4 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 10

LED 6: EQU C_Step.ACC 5 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 9

LED 7: EQU C_Step.ACC 6 OR EQU C_Step.ACC 8

LED 8: EQU C_Step.ACC 7
